The sorption mechanism of Au(III) on sulfur-containing chelating resin poly[4-vinylbenzyl (2-hydroxyethyl) sulfide]
Authors:Rongjun Qu  Changmei Sun  Chunnuan Ji  Chunhua Wang
Institution:a School of Chemistry and Materials Science, Yantai Normal University, Yantai 264025, PR China
b School of Materials Science and Engineering, Tianjin University, Tianjin 300072, PR China
Abstract:The sorption mechanism of sulfur-containing chelating resin, poly4-vinylbenzyl (2-hydroxyethyl) sulfide], towards Au(III) was investigated by Fourier transform infrared spectra (FTIR), X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(XPS), scanning electron microscopy (SEM), energy dispersive X-ray microanalysis (EDX), and X-ray diffraction (XRD). It was showed that the sulfide bond in the resin was oxidized into sulfoxide and sulfone bond, and Au(III) was deoxidized into Au(0).
Keywords:Poly[4-vinylbenzyl (2-hydroxyethyl) sulfide]  Sorption mechanism  Au(III)  Redox
